This question is about a couple living in Israel with an Israeli citizenship, and currently both have no immigration status in the US (aside from a tourist visa). They are both applying for a green card (permanent residency in the US).
Once they receive the immigration visa from the US Embassy, they plan to sell their home and move to the US.
The concern is whether the home sale, or any other income earned in Israel during that year prior to entering the US, will be taxed in that calendar year.
